package repository
import (
"context"
"github.com/DATA-DOG/go-sqlmock"
"github.com/jmoiron/sqlx"
"github.com/stretchr/testify/require"
"go.uber.org/zap"
"testing"
)
func TestContestRepository_CreateContest(t *testing.T) {
t.Parallel()
db, mock, err := sqlmock.New(sqlmock.QueryMatcherOption(sqlmock.QueryMatcherEqual))
require.NoError(t, err)
defer db.Close()
sqlxDB := sqlx.NewDb(db, "sqlmock")
defer sqlxDB.Close()
contestRepo := NewContestRepository(sqlxDB, zap.NewNop())
t.Run("valid contest creation", func(t *testing.T) {
title := "Contest title"
rows := sqlmock.NewRows([]string{"id"}).AddRow(1)
mock.ExpectQuery(sqlxDB.Rebind(createContestQuery)).WithArgs(title).WillReturnRows(rows)
id, err := contestRepo.CreateContest(context.Background(), title)
require.NoError(t, err)
require.Equal(t, int32(1), id)
})
}
func TestContestRepository_DeleteContest(t *testing.T) {
t.Parallel()
db, mock, err := sqlmock.New(sqlmock.QueryMatcherOption(sqlmock.QueryMatcherEqual))
require.NoError(t, err)
defer db.Close()
sqlxDB := sqlx.NewDb(db, "sqlmock")
defer sqlxDB.Close()
contestRepo := NewContestRepository(sqlxDB, zap.NewNop())
t.Run("valid contest deletion", func(t *testing.T) {
id := int32(1)
rows := sqlmock.NewResult(1, 1)
mock.ExpectExec(sqlxDB.Rebind(deleteContestQuery)).WithArgs(id).WillReturnResult(rows)
err = contestRepo.DeleteContest(context.Background(), id)
require.NoError(t, err)
})
}
